Jeremy Ruston is a founder and seasoned software leader based in Oxford with 14 years of formal industry experience and a programming journey that began in 1978. He created TiddlyWiki, a widely used open-source personal organiser that has become a platform for novel web applications, and continues to lead its community and development (see his active GitHub). Jeremy combines hands-on daily coding with founding and CTO roles across startups and enterprise teams in banking, telecoms and collaboration software, repeatedly building high-performing engineering organisations. His work blends product-focused design, open source advocacy and pragmatic architecture—evident from projects like TiddlyDesktop where he implemented cross-platform build and packaging features. He is fascinated by how society adapts to software’s possibilities and consults on challenging engagements around collaboration and the web. Beyond evident credentials, his career traces a continuous thread from early freelance technical authorship and TV animation to steering modern web tooling and community-driven products.
